About the MARINER 47 (BREWER)

Mariner Yacht Co. built about 7-8 of these boats before going out of business. Later, about 6 more were built and sold as the ISLANDER 48C. Thanks to the designer, Ted Brewer for providing corrections. See ISLANDER 48C for more details.

Sailpages Buyer's Take

The Mariner 47 is a rare, heavy-displacement cruising sloop designed by Ted Brewer and built by Mariner Yacht Company in the USA. With only 7 hulls built in 1980, this vessel represents a small-production, high-quality build from the early 1980s.

Best for:
This boat suits experienced coastal cruisers and those seeking a comfortable, stable passage-making vessel, given its high comfort ratio and substantial displacement. It is well-suited for couples or small families who prioritize sea-kindliness and interior volume over high-performance racing.
Bluewater capability:
With a displacement of 29500.0 lb and a capsize ratio of 1.79, the Mariner 47 exhibits strong offshore stability and safety margins suitable for protected bluewater passages.
